American Airlines Expands Flagship Dining Access

Flagship Dining, the premium American Airlines sit-down dining experience available in Flagship lounges at Dallas Fort Worth International Airport (DFW) and Miami International Airport (MIA), is expanding access eligibility to more customers. To further enhance the experience, American is introducing an exclusive wine and chocolate pairing featuring KHK Wines and K+M Extravirgin Chocolate for Flagship Dining guests. Chef Thomas Keller, who co-founded K+M Extravirgin Chocolate with Italian olive oil producer Armando Manni and is a founding ambassador in KHK Wines, curated the pairing. The offering will also be available at The Chelsea Lounge club at John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K), adding another elevated touch to American’s most premium lounge experiences.

Beginning Sept. 15, customers traveling in Flagship Business Plus and Flagship Business on qualifying long-haul international, transcontinental and Hawaii Flagship routes can enjoy access to Flagship Dining—an opportunity previously offered to only those traveling in Flagship First.

“At American, we’re continually looking for ways to elevate the customer experience and create moments that make travel more memorable,” said American’s SVP of Customer Experience and Design Rhonda Crawford. “By expanding access to Flagship Dining and introducing new menu enhancements, including an exclusive wine and chocolate pairing from KHK Wines and K+M Extravirgin Chocolate curated by Chef Thomas Keller, we’re delivering an even more elevated hospitality experience that begins well before customers step on board.”
